It was started as a social media experiment back in 2010 by founder James Doe.
Since then it has turned in to a huge platform for non-league clubs to showcase what they are about, while welcoming bumper crowds to their matches due to the lack of match action further up the pyramid.
This year it takes place on Saturday, March 26 and Doe told talkSPORT how the idea came about, saying:
“I followed QPR and my local non-league team Harrow since the 80s and so I did have a bit of a background in both, but when I went away to university I lost touch with my non-league club," he admitted.
“I went to watch QPR in a pre-season game in Tavistock and it was obvious how big a day it was for Tavistock despite the fact it was just a friendly. There were adverts all over town, on the sides of buses and I went down, the ground was packed to the rafters and it was clear that the money would really help them for the season.
“I then went to watch Harrow a week or two later and they were doing a fundraiser for floodlight bulbs which I thought was strange for a club that were playing at a fairly senior level. I thought it would be a routine cost, but it wasn’t.
“It wasn’t long after the financial crash of 2008 and it was evident that clubs were struggling and that crowds were dwindling.
“I had this eureka moment where I realised there was an international break coming up and England weren’t playing on the day itself, and so I thought there were fans who would be hanging around and we really enjoyed our trips to non-league and so I thought that fans of Premier League clubs might also enjoy watching football, even if it wasn’t their team.
“I set up an event on Facebook and sent it to a few friends for a laugh and it sort of went viral, meaning that within six weeks I had a national event on my hands!”
With billionaire owners and state-owned clubs now dominating football at the highest level, it's easy to forget that the sport still exists in local and regional communities.
The cost of attending a Premier League match has grown astronomically in recent years due to the global audience that it attracts, but with , supporters can find a non-league match that's local to them for a fraction of the price.
Doe explained: "Non League Day is primarily a showcase to show that these clubs exist, showcase that the standard of football is probably a lot higher than they think and shows how accessible and affordable football at that level is.
“It’s the entry fee, the price of food and drink, the fact you can get close to the action and talk to the players afterwards, not to mention the financial boost for the club themselves.
“Every pound makes a difference at this level, so while only 10 extra people might show up, that’s 10 people who might not have been there and that could pay for the referee.
“A relatively small amount of money goes a long way at non-league level and so you will make a difference if you go and see your local club play this weekend."
